A Novel Ferro-Aging-Related Gene Signature for Prognosis and Targeted Drug Prediction in Cervical Cancer

<title>Abstract</title> <p> Objective Cervical cancer (CESC) remains a leading cause of cancer-related mortality in women. Recent studies have identified ferro-aging as a genuine biological pathway in primates, representing an iron-dependent metabolic process.
